Licensing in Dynamics 365 CE is bit complicated as we have maaany options to choose from 🙂 . And often, there is a confusion around what’s in an Enterprise license and what’s in professional license. There is a difference of ~30$ per month between these two and its important to know whats missing in Sales Professional license.
Few things to consider before we proceed to find the differences:
- A tenant can have a combination of Sales Professional and Sales Enterprise, however within an instance, we cannot use both together. It should be either Enterprise or Professional. So we should take decision based on the features required.
- Team member add on license can be added to both
- Its possible to move from Sales Professional application to Sales Enterprise application (and vice versa)

Comparison chart Sales Professional vs Sales Enterprise

Sales Professional is limited to a maximum of the following whereas Sales Enterprise has no limit on these:
- 15 Custom Entities
- 5 Business Process Flows
- 15 Custom Queues
- 10 3rd Party App Installs
- 2 Custom Forms
- 5 Custom Reports, Charts and Dashboards
Sales Professional does not have access to:
- Marketing Lists
- Marketing Campaigns
- Embedded Intelligence
- Quick Campaigns
- Forecasting
- Sales Playbooks
- Competitors
- Sales Goals and Territory Management
- Product Taxonomy & Relationships
- Hierarchies
- Social Engagement/Gamification
